WebJun 4, 2013 · If you could let's disable it, then run the update and reboot, then we can re enable it. You can disable by running the following racadm command - C:\rac>racadm –r x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x –u root –p calvin set LifecycleController.LCAttributes.CollectSystemInventoryOnRestart Disabled Where the … WebMay 3, 2024 · My only way out of this has been to unplug power + all USB drives, reboot a couple times until I can get to the UEFI boot options, boot back into the SLI image, and reinstall iDRAC 1.66.65.00 and LifeCycle Controller 1.4.2.12. WebMar 23, 2024 · What I suggest is to do the following; 1. Power down the system 2. Removed all PCIe cards. 3. Powered on the system 4. Verify if the iDrac successfully starts 5. If so update the BIOS and iDrac, if they are far behind you will need to walk both up to current together. 6. Reboot and verify every posts successfully. 7. Power down the system 8. WebOct 28, 2013 · 2. Unplug USB devices and Enter the Lifecycle Controller. Untick the “Collect Hardware Inventory on Reboot”. Plug USB back in and reboot. Note: the downside to option 2 is that it disables the automated system for sending hardware failures to Dell for Pro Support replacement. WebDec 7, 2024 · The LCC is dependent on the iDRAC to work. If the iDRAC is functional then I would update the iDRAC firmware to the latest and also the system BIOS. If the LCC will still not work then disconnect all power to drain flea power from the system.
